What Are T5 Aquarium Lights and How Do They Function in Aquarium Systems?
T5 aquarium lights are specialized fluorescent lights designed for use in aquatic environments. They provide essential lighting for plant growth and fish health in aquarium systems.
- Structure and Wattage
- Spectrum Range
- Energy Efficiency
- Lifespan
- Heat Production
- Types of Fixtures
- Installation and Maintenance
Understanding T5 aquarium lights requires examining each component and how they contribute to effective aquarium lighting.
-
Structure and Wattage:
T5 aquarium lights have a slim, tubular structure with a diameter of 5/8 inch. They are available in various wattages, typically ranging from 24W to 80W. The wattage of a T5 light affects its brightness and suitability for different types of aquariums. -
Spectrum Range:
T5 lights provide a range of color spectrums, typically from 6500K to 10000K. These values indicate the color temperature, with higher numbers representing a bluer light. Spectrum range is crucial for promoting photosynthesis in aquatic plants and enhancing the appearance of fish. -
Energy Efficiency:
T5 lights are known for their energy efficiency. They offer higher light output per watt compared to traditional fluorescent bulbs. This efficiency translates to lower electricity costs for aquarium owners, making them a popular choice for both freshwater and marine setups. -
Lifespan:
T5 bulbs usually have a lifespan of 20,000 hours or more with proper usage. This longevity reduces the need for frequent replacement, making T5 lights cost-effective over time. Regularly replacing bulbs is essential to maintain optimal light levels in aquariums. -
Heat Production:
T5 lights produce less heat than other lighting types, such as metal halides. This lower heat output helps maintain stable water temperatures in aquariums. This is particularly important for sensitive species that require a stable thermal environment. -
Types of Fixtures:
T5 lights come in various fixture types, including single, double, or quadruple configurations. The choice of fixture can affect how much light reaches plants and corals in the tank. AquaIllumination and Current USA are popular brands offering diverse fixture options. -
Installation and Maintenance:
T5 lights are relatively easy to install and can often be retrofitted into existing lighting systems. Maintenance includes cleaning the bulbs and reflectors to maximize light output. Regular checks ensure that the aquarist can respond quickly to any issues that may arise.
Each of these factors plays a significant role in how T5 aquarium lights function within an aquarium system. They balance energy consumption, light quality, and plant growth requirements effectively.
Why Are T5 Fixtures Considered Beneficial for Aquarium Lighting?
T5 fixtures are considered beneficial for aquarium lighting due to their energy efficiency, superior light quality, and versatility in supporting marine and freshwater ecosystems. These fixtures are popular among aquarists for their ability to promote plant growth and enhance fish coloration.
According to the U.S. Department of Energy, T5 refers to a type of fluorescent lamp that is 5/8 inches in diameter. The term “T5” indicates the size and type of the bulb, which operates efficiently within specific spectrums optimal for aquatic life.
The underlying reasons for the advantages of T5 fixtures include their high lumen output, which provides bright illumination. Lumens measure light output. T5 bulbs also emit light across a spectrum that closely resembles natural sunlight, benefiting photosynthesis in aquatic plants. The efficiency of T5 fixtures allows for lower energy consumption compared to older fluorescent technologies.
T5 bulbs utilize a combination of phosphors to produce light. These phosphors are chemical compounds that emit visible light when excited by electricity. The technology in T5 fixtures ensures a longer life span, typically exceeding 24,000 hours, which reduces the frequency of bulb replacements.
Specific conditions that enhance the effectiveness of T5 lighting include proper placement and complementary use with reflectors. For instance, positioning T5 fixtures at appropriate distances from the water surface maximizes light penetration. Aquarists can also use reflectors to direct light efficiently throughout the tank. Additionally, T5 fixtures can accommodate various bulb types, including those tailored for plant growth or fish health, enabling customization based on the specific needs of the aquarium.

What Key Features Should You Consider When Choosing T5 Bulbs for Reef Aquariums?
When choosing T5 bulbs for reef aquariums, consider the following key features:
- Color Temperature
- Bulb Spectrum
- Wattage and Length
- Quality and Brand
- Lifespan
- Compatibility
Understanding these features is essential for selecting the right T5 bulbs for optimum reef health and growth.
-
Color Temperature:
Color temperature refers to the hue of light emitted by a bulb, measured in Kelvin (K). For reef aquariums, a color temperature between 10,000K and 20,000K is ideal. This range offers a balance of blue and white light, promoting coral growth and enhancing tank aesthetics. Research indicates that corals thrive better under light conditions close to 12,000K (Smith et al., 2021). -
Bulb Spectrum:
Bulb spectrum signifies the range of wavelengths emitted by the T5 bulb. It is crucial for photosynthesis in corals and algae. A full-spectrum bulb simulates natural sunlight. This spectrum includes a mix of blue, red, and green wavelengths crucial for coral health. Full-spectrum bulbs support a broader variety of marine life, as indicated by a study published by Marine Bio Research in 2022. -
Wattage and Length:
Wattage indicates the energy consumption of the bulb, while length refers to its physical size. Selecting the correct wattage ensures adequate illumination based on aquarium depth and size. Typically, T5 bulbs come in lengths of 24, 36, and 48 inches, accommodating various tank sizes. Proper wattage ensures optimal PAR (photosynthetically active radiation) levels, which is imperative for healthy coral growth. -
Quality and Brand:
Quality and brand play significant roles in the longevity and performance of T5 bulbs. Well-established brands often offer better performance and reliability. Consumer reviews suggest that reputable brands like ATI and Giesemann outperform lesser-known manufacturers in both bulb lifespan and light quality (Aquarium Sciences, 2023). -
Lifespan:
Lifespan refers to how long a bulb will effectively provide light. T5 bulbs generally last between 10,000 to 15,000 hours, with performance declining towards the end of their lifespan. Regularly replacing bulbs ensures consistent light output, vital for coral growth and overall aquarium health. -
Compatibility:
Compatibility pertains to whether the T5 bulb fits the existing lighting fixture. Ensure the selected bulbs match the fixture’s wattage and length specifications. Using mismatched components can lead to inadequate lighting and even damage the fixture. Compatibility checks can prevent costly replacements and headaches in the aquarium setup.

What Maintenance Practices Should Be Implemented for T5 Aquarium Lighting?
The essential maintenance practices for T5 aquarium lighting include regular bulb replacement, cleaning the fixtures, ensuring proper electrical connection, and monitoring light intensity.
- Regular bulb replacement
- Cleaning the fixtures
- Ensuring proper electrical connection
- Monitoring light intensity
Transitioning to the detailed explanation, it’s important to understand the significance of each maintenance practice for T5 aquarium lighting.
-
Regular Bulb Replacement: Regular bulb replacement is crucial for maintaining optimal light levels in your aquarium. T5 bulbs typically last between 10 to 14 months, depending on usage. When bulbs age, their light output diminishes, which can negatively impact plant growth and overall tank health. The Marine Conservation Society recommends replacing bulbs annually to ensure your aquarium maintains the necessary light spectrum.
-
Cleaning the Fixtures: Cleaning the fixtures is an essential maintenance practice for T5 aquarium lighting. Dust and algae can accumulate on the fixtures and bulbs, reducing light penetration. This can hinder the growth of aquatic plants and lead to undesirable tank conditions. It is advisable to clean the fixtures every month using a soft cloth or sponge without harsh chemicals, as these can damage the fixtures.
-
Ensuring Proper Electrical Connection: Ensuring proper electrical connection is vital for the safe operation of T5 lighting. Loose or damaged connections can cause flickering lights or even electrical hazards. Inspect the connections regularly for wear and secure any loose wires to prevent shorts. Safety standards set by organizations, such as Underwriters Laboratories (UL), emphasize the importance of checking electrical connections in aquarium lighting systems.
-
Monitoring Light Intensity: Monitoring light intensity is important for maintaining the health of aquatic life. T5 lights can produce significant light, which may vary based on bulb age and fixture cleanliness. A light meter can help measure the intensity and adjust as necessary to prevent excessive light that can lead to algae blooms. Research by the American Fisheries Society highlights that too much light can disrupt the balance in an aquarium, negatively affecting fish and plant health.
By implementing these maintenance practices, aquarium owners can ensure a thriving environment for their aquatic life.
